您现在的位置是:首页 > PLC技术 > PLC技术
FX2系列PLC的加法指令
来源:艾特贸易2017-06-04
简介该指令的助记符、指令代码、操作数和程序步如表 5. 20 所示。 表 5.20 加法指令要素 加法指令 ADD 的应用如图 5.28 和图 5.29 所示。 ADD 加法指令是将指定的源元件中的二进制数相加,结果
该指令的助记符、指令代码、操作数和程序步如表5. 20所示。 表5.20 加法指令要素 加法指令ADD的应用如图5.28和图5.29所示。 ADD加法指令是将指定的源元件中的二进制数相加,结果送到指定的目标元件中去。每个数据的最高位作为符号位(0为正,1为负)。运算总是代数运算,如: 5+(-8)= -3
图5.28 加法指令ADD的应用之一
图5.29 加法指令ADD的应用之二 ADD加法指令有3个常用标志。M8020为零标志,M8021为借位标志,M8022为进位标志。如果运算结果为o,则零标志位M8020置1。如果运算结果超过32767 (16位运算)或2147483647 (32位运算),则进位标志位M8022置1。如果运算结果小于32767(16位运算)或2147483647(32位运算),则借位标志M8021置1。在32位运算中,用到字元件时,被指定的字元件是低16位元件,而其下一个元件即为高16位元件。为了避免重复使用某些元件,建议指定操作元件时用偶数元件号。 源和目标可以用相同的元件号,若源和目标元件号相同而且采用连续执行的ADD/(D) ADD指令时,加法的结果在每个扫描周期都会改变。应用如图5.29所示。 图5.29所示程序,每当X0从OFF变为ON时,D0的数据加1。这与INC (P)指令的执行结果相似。其不同之处在于用ADD指令时,零、借位、进位标志将按前述方法置位。
点击排行
